This study investigates the relationship between corporate social responsibility (CSR) committees' mandates, the characteristicsof their chairs, and corporate environmental performance. Employing the whole sample of Italian industrial firms listed onEuronext Milan, we find that only sustainability-focused CSR committees are positively associated with corporate environmen-tal performance. Moreover, specific characteristics of committee chairs in sustainability-focused CSR committees are signifi-cantly linked to corporate environmental performance. Chairs with executive roles and longer tenure are positively associatedwith corporate environmental performance. These results highlight the importance of committee structure, clarity of mandates,and the characteristics of committee chairs in shaping corporate environmental strategies, as well as offer practical and theoret-ical implications.
